OK folks, hear me out. I have recently researched and presented on how the Ukraine War will affect global food prices for my work. And it literally made me sick to my stomach. What I found is that Russia and Ukraine export nearly 50% of the world's sunflower oil for cooking. And because of the war, pandemic, lack of supply chains and lack of fertilizer coming in the next year there is going to be a rise in global hunger, and I can't fix that, but I also can't sit idly by. And of course, developing countries are going to bear the brunt of this. The help I am asking for is not for me, but for a friend.

As some of you know, I have worked in West Africa, many years ago, and have a dear friend; a hard working, agriculturally minded friend there, that I have kept in touch with, and I am frankly worried for him, his family's and their country's well being.

In The Gambia, they are heavily reliant on oil for cooking their food. And with this global shortage of sunflower oil, coupled with other exporting countries banning exports of their oil (Indonesia and their palm oil), I fear for those most vulnerable.
